    Electrical Engineer

    JOB PURPOSE & ACCOUNTABILITIES:

    Purpose

    • Manage all Electrical Engineering activities and deliverables for major projects and asset support.
    • Provide Electrical Engineering Support and steer in Concept definition, FEED, Detailed Engineering design, Installation and Construction phases of the project and to support tendering processes for all Projects.
    • Participate in Site Coordination meeting with Contractor, Site project audits/constructability reviews, Activity kick-off meeting, HSE workshops, quality and technical reviews to assure overall facilities integrity and safe operations.
    • Participate in design reviews at FEED and detailed design, especially SAFOP.

     

    Accountabilities

    • Electrical discipline engineer for the PDT handling multiple project responsibilities.
    • Execute technical work for FEED and Detailed Designs (designs, specifications, drawings, etc.) within designated CTR scopes.
    • Follow-on engineering: Remain engaged in design issues and decisions throughout construction, commissioning and start-up.
    • Ensure quality of technical work and the technical integrity, functionality, constructability, safe operation and reliability of designs.
    • Contribute to excellent HSE performance throughout the engineering phase of the project life cycle.
    • Provide technical input to project electrical deliverables at all phases of major projects
    • Review and provide technical assurance to electrical engineering deliverables.
    • Contribute to the development of equipment specifications during detailed engineering design and ensure compliance with Shell/project standards and specifications during equipment procurement and FAT.
    • Ensure buy-in of relevant authorities, including Heads of Disciplines/project leadership, as required, in the resolution of electrical issues.
    • Ensure alignment with local regulatory and requirements and discipline standards.
    • Ensure the application of Shell Electrical Safety Rules (ESR) during execution.
    • Contribute and partake in all technical and Safety audits and design reviews (e.g. HAZOP, SAFOP, peer reviews, design reviews etc) to ensure compliance with legislation and Shell global policies, guidelines and standards.
    • Ensure drive to achieve Goal Zero at the Project worksite and support the implementation of site HSE Management Plan for the project at site level.
    • Contribute to contracting strategies, ITT Technical scoping and tender evaluations.
    • Supervise and co-ordinate all site Electrical execution activities for projects in line with the agreed schedule and in accordance to the design, engineering and construction requirements using approved plans, procedures and specifications
    • Interface efficiently with Asset team, projects’ operation support team, Service Providers and Statutory bodies, ensuring that requirements are fulfilled in design.
    • Evolve and manage suitable strategy for identification, documentation and Integration on lessons learnt from other related projects, recently completed or ongoing within SCiN to leverage project performance
    • Participate in review of Work method statements (WMS), plans and procedure; Risks assessments and Job hazard analysis (JHA); and the Project execution schedule and work activities plan.
    • Support Projects with Site Coordination meeting with Contractor, Site project audits/constructability reviews, Activity kick-off meeting, HSE workshops, quality and technical reviews to assure overall facilities integrity and safe operations.

    QUALIFICATIONS

    • Electrical Engineering graduate with a minimum of a Bachelor’s Degree in Electrical Engineering, registered with COREN & NSE.
    • Minimum of 7 years + electrical engineering practice in the Oil & Gas industry.
    • Good working knowledge of a broad range of electrical engineering systems and tools and understanding of the EP business and other discipline needs.
    • Conversant with Nigerian and International oil and gas facilities design codes and standards.

    SKILLS & REQUIREMENTS

    Demonstrates the following technical competencies:

    • Power Supply & Systems Design Philosophy
    • Identify Electrical Power Requirements
    • Define Electrical Power Sources
    • Define Electrical System Philosophy & Network Configuration
    • Define Main Transmission & Distribution Systems
    • Execute Electrical Feasibility Studies

    Electrical safety & engineering support

    • Develop and Integrate Electrical Safety in Design, Construction, Commissioning & Operation
    • Provide Electrical Specialist Support to Maintenance & Operations
    • Provide Electrical Specialist Support for Construction & Commissioning

    System Parameters, Control & Protection Systems

    • Specify Electrical System Parameters and Control
    • Specify & Verify Electrical Protection Systems

    Electrical Equipment & Detail Engineering

    • Conduct Detailed Studies, Define Documentation & Select Equipment
    • Specify Power Systems
    • Specify Electrical Drive Systems
    • Specify Transmission & Distribution Requirements
    • Specify Electromagnetic Compatibility, Earthing & Lightning Protection
    • Specify Heating, Ventilating & Lighting/Utility systems
    • Specify Requirements for Hazardous Areas
